Blood Vessels

Artery:

Contains:
  • Endothelium intima
  • Thick Tunica Media (with smooth muscle and elastic fibres), to deal with the high pressure blood and allows the arteries to recoil
  • Has a relatively thick tunica externa
  • Relatively smaller lumen
  • Has high pressure pulsitile blood
Function=To carry high pressure blood away from the heart 

Capillary:

Contains:
  • Endothelium made up of 1 layer thick squamous epithelium (thin walls)
  • 1 RBC thick lumen
  • Average blood pressure
Function=Exchange vessel to the organs

Vein:

Contains:
  • Endothelium intima
  • Relatively thinner Tunica media
  • Thinner tunica externa
  • Valves, prevent the backflow of blood aiding its return (if valves fail to close then it can result in varicose veins or the build up of blood)
  • Very large lumen
  • Very low blood pressure
Function=Carry blood to the heart

Arterioles:

Function=Are able to contract forcing blood to go through a seperate tube straight into the venules. Also connect the arteries to the capillaries.

Venules:

Function=Connects veins to the capillaries
